Cost of Concrete Foundation Leveling in Kansas City, MO

Concrete foundation leveling in Kansas City, MO, typically involves adjusting or lifting a settled or uneven foundation to restore stability and proper alignment. The final cost of such projects can vary widely depending on factors such as the scope of work, the materials used, labor requirements, and specific site conditions. Factors Influencing Cost

Concrete foundation leveling is a process used to address uneven or settling concrete slabs in Kansas City, MO. This service helps restore stability and prevent further damage to structures such as patios, driveways, and basement floors. Understanding typical project considerations can assist property owners in evaluating options and estimating costs.

  • Materials: Commonly involves polyurethane foam or mudjacking mixtures, chosen based on project size and soil conditions.
  • Size and Scope: Suitable for small to large slabs, with scope varying from minor lifts to extensive foundation adjustments.
  • Labor Complexity: Requires specialized equipment and techniques, often involving skilled labor for precise application.
  • Permitting: Generally does not require extensive permits but may depend on local building codes and project extent.
  • Additional Services: May include crack repair, drainage improvements, or soil stabilization to enhance long-term stability.
